What You’ll Tackle
- Act as the front-line technical expert for enterprise prospects and customers, guiding them from first conversation through full-scale adoption of a next-generation security platform.
- Translate business and risk priorities into secure architecture proposals that deliver clear return on investment.
- Drive engaging product walk-throughs, whiteboards, and proof-of-concepts that win stakeholder confidence from SOC analysts to the C-suite.
- Strengthen alliances with channel, cloud, and technology partners to unlock new revenue paths.
- Evangelize thought leadership at virtual and on-site conferences, webinars, and community meet-ups.
- Produce repeatable enablement collateral—demo scripts, reference architectures, explainer videos—to multiply field success.
- Feed real-world insight back to product, engineering, and marketing teams to influence roadmap and messaging.
- Own technical success criteria during trials: scoping, configuration, success measurement, and executive readouts.
- Stay ahead of emerging threats, industry frameworks, and upcoming releases to advise customers on best practices.
- Plan for moderate North American travel (around 20%) to meet with key customers and participate in major industry conferences.
The Expertise We’re After
- Bachelor’s degree in computer science, Engineering, Cybersecurity (or equivalent hands-on experience).
- 5 + years in customer-facing pre-sales / solutions / sales engineering for security or cloud platforms.
- Track record of steering large-enterprise stakeholders through complex security evaluations and purchasing cycles.
- Hands-on familiarity with at least one major cloud provider (AWS, Azure, GCP) plus modern security tooling such as XDR, SIEM, CSPM, or CNAPP.
- Broad understanding of network protocols, identity & access, automation / DevSecOps pipelines, and zero-trust principles.
- Stellar communication skills—capable of tailoring depth to audiences ranging from practitioners to executives.
- Nice-to-have extras: scripting or automation (Python, PowerShell, Bash), incident-response or threat-hunting experience, certifications such as CISSP, CCSP, AWS SA, or Kubernetes CKA.
